Get started31 Parsons Lane is a four-bedroom semi-detached house in Bierton, Aylesbury, Aylesbury (HP22 5DF). It has a recorded floor area of 83 m² (around 893 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1950-1966 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(March 2016) shows a D (score 55), a step below the typical UK home. When first surveyed in August 2012 the rating was E,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, hot-water efficiency went from Average to Good and lighting went from Average to Good; while roof efficiency dropped from Very Good to Good.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 79). The latest certificate is from March 2016, so improvements made since then won't be reflected. Records show the property has been extended at some point in its history. The home occupies a cul-de-sac position.
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 10.1%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£548,000 is 28.9% above the 2018 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£476/sq ft) was about 85.9% above the typical sold price in the postcode. One planning record on file: an extension approved in 2015. Past consents include an extension and partial demolition,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. Last sale on file: £425,000 in November 2018.
